1994: Leslie Jean-Pierre served as a Peace Corps Volunteer in Guinea, West Africa in Donghel Sigon beginning in 1994
Returned Peace Corps Volunteer Leslie Jean-Pierre can be contacted at leslieatjpnetworkingdcom
Country of Service: Guinea, West Africa
Cities you served in: Donghel Sigon
Arrival Year: 1994
Departure Year: 1996
Work Description:
Health/Community Development Volunteer.
Bring us up to date on your life after the peace corps:
Worked for 6 years at the New York Regional Peace Corps Office as a Recruiter. Received my MPA. Traveled to Asia, Africa, Eastern Europe and throughout America. Owner of an IT Development and Web Design Business.
Any thoughts you have now looking back on peace corps days?:
Things are often taken for granted. Enjoy every moment and make the best of any situation.
Any message for returned volunteers?:
Use what you learn from your experience as a volunteer to your advantage in school or work.
